John joined The Lions on 11th March 2022 following his release from Kidsgrove Athletic and he has plenty of experience in the Vanarama National League North.
Before arriving at Nethermoor the midfielder has played for Salford, Altrincham. Alfreton Town and Chester where he was signed for an undisclosed fee.
On the signing then Joint Manager Russ O’Neill said “JJ is a fabulous signing for the club, the calibre of player that I thought was out of reach for us here at Guiseley at this stage of his career if I’m honest. I know JJ inside out and I have kept in contact with him ever since selling him to Salford, he was electric for us as a youngster and really excelled.”
“He’s now 27 and with two league titles under his belt at Salford and then further titles at Altrincham and numerous transfer fees later he is coming to us with fantastic experience and at a great age. He knows the type of environment we try to create and rises to that challenge, I will be looking for him to be more than just a good young player now.”
“If we can get him to half the player we sold I’m sure he will be a big hit with the supporters and players alike.”
John made his Lions debut a day after his signature against Boston United.
John’s contract runs until the end of the 2022/23 season.
On 11th October 2022 it was announced that John Johnston had left the club to join Matlock Town for an undisclosed fee.
